  • Well-designed and very comfortable. But the quality of presentation is erratic. They cut the end credits off the last reel of "Australia" so the movie abruptly ends, the music suddenly cuts out and the house lights come up; the filmmakers worked to create a feeling at the end of the movie, and this theater decided to destroy it so they could turn over the room faster. On another occasion, the picture (printed 1.33 to be projected with a 1.85 matte) was framed incorrectly, with so much extra head-room the microphone was visible; I pointed this out to the manager and (after getting angry) they reframed it wrong again, this time with too much room at the bottom, cutting actors' heads off. There's really no excuse for this in a technically well-equipped theater like this, and the distributors would no doubt be unhappy if they knew how carelessly their films are being presented. All it would take to correct these problems is a little consistent care, and this theater would be great.
